Coprocessor crash via out-of-bounds framebuffer write
Published Oct 24, 2024 · Updated Apr 2, 2026
An out-of-bounds write in IOMobileFrameBuffer in Apple macOS before 14.6 allows local users to crash a coprocessor through an app. IOMobileFrameBuffer insufficiently validates app-supplied input before a buffer write; Apple has not disclosed the affected function or input format. Reaching the flaw requires local low-privileged app execution, and the documented consequence is a coprocessor crash rather than code execution or data disclosure.
